About the Book
This Fourth Edition by Gitesh Amrohit is a fully refined and expanded resource designed to meet the academic and clinical needs of physiotherapy students and practitioners. With added content tailored for classroom learning, clinical postings, ward duties, and professional practice, this edition ensures easy access to relevant, practical information across all physiotherapy domains.

All topics are presented in a point-wise format and written in simple, lucid language, making learning faster, clearer, and more efficient. Enhanced with well-drawn illustrations and line graphics, the book provides visual clarity and strengthens conceptual understanding.

Updated with the latest information, this edition includes expanded sections on biochemical and hematological values, pharmacology, and essential references across various physiotherapy specialties. Its comprehensive coverage makes it highly valuable for undergraduates, postgraduates, physiotherapists, and rehabilitation specialists seeking a complete, up-to-date reference for academic study and clinical application.
